Tyrell Malacia, the 25-year-old Dutch left-back, has completed a loan move from Manchester United to PSV Eindhoven. The deal includes an option for a permanent transfer worth €10 million, along with a 30% sell-on clause for Manchester United.

This season, Malacia made 9 appearances for Manchester United. According to Transfermarkt, his current market value stands at €15 million.
